Hannah Dale is a contemporary British illustrator known for her charming and detailed depictions of wildlife. Her work often features animals rendered with a delicate touch, capturing the essence of British countryside fauna. Dale's illustrations are celebrated for their intricate details and whimsical charm, making them popular in various forms of merchandise and publications.
Hannah Dale's Midjourney style is characterized by its detailed and cute portrayal of animals, using fine lines and pastel colors. The illustrations are realistic yet whimsical, with a focus on gentle and charming atmospheres. Techniques such as watercolor and ink on textured paper are employed to create soft textures and naturalistic details. The compositions often feature a central focus with minimal backgrounds, allowing the animal subjects to stand out. The color palette includes earth tones and soft pastels, contributing to the warm and inviting feel of the artwork.
